Nintendo has confirmed the development of a new Mario movie is underway.


In a tweet earlier today, the home of the moustachioed plumber announced that a Mario movie is in the works with assistance from Illumination, the studio who brought us Despicable Me and Minions.

Chris Meledandri from Illumination and Nintendo’s Shigeru Miyamoto are both listed as producers on the project.

That’s about all they’ve been willing to spill at this stage, so we have no idea when the film will be out or who we can expect to see in the starring role. Surely, Charles Martinet is going to be everyone’s first choice, though, considering he’s been the voice actor for Mario since the early ’90s.

At the end of last year, Nintendo released the phenomenal Super Mario Odyssey, a game we called an ‘absolute joy’ in our review.
